Currently, the cost of battery-based energy storage in India is INR 10.18/kWh, as discovered in a SECI auction for 500 MW/1000 MWh BESS. The government has launched viability gap funding and Production-Linked Incentive (PLI) schemes to make battery storage affordable.

As per National Electricity Plan (NEP) 2023 of Central Electricity Authority (CEA), the energy storage capacity requirement is projected to be 82.37 GWh (47.65 GWh from PSP and 34.72 GWh from BESS) in year 2026-27. This requirement is further expected to increase to 411.4 GWh (175.18 GWh from PSP.

Who is the largest ESS developer in India?
in the Indian Grid-scale ESS MarketSource: JMK ResearchAs of November 2023, in terms of capacity won, Greenko is the largest grid-scale ESS developer n India, with a total allotted capacity of more than 2GW.
